    What Is A Torn Meniscus?

    Located in-between the thighbone and shinbone, the meniscus is a piece of cartilage that cushions this connection point. When the meniscus is torn, the following symptoms can be experienced:

     

    • Pain
    • Swelling
    • Stiffness/issues with mobility
    • Popping sensation
    • Knee instability

     

    Causes Of A Torn Meniscus

    A meniscus often tears due to a forceful twisting of the knee, but kneeling or squatting can also cause the injury. This often occurs in sports with physical contact or sharp pivoting, such as football, basketball, and tennis.

    A meniscus can also tear quite easily in those with degenerative knee issues. It could take little to no impact to cause injury to these individuals. Obesity can also increase this risk.

    Home remedies are often enough to treat a tear in the meniscus. Some techniques include:

    • Rest – giving your knee time to heal and avoiding movements that would increase pain; crutches can help in cases of higher pain
    • Medication – over-the-counter pain relief medication
    • Ice – applying ice to reduce swelling and pain

    Beyond treating the injury yourself, physical therapy can help build strength around the knee, improving its stability.

    Meniscus Tear

    Your knee is made up of an inner and outer meniscus. Your meniscus consists of 2 C-shaped pieces of cartilage that act as a cushion between your shin and thigh bone. A meniscus tear is one of the most common knee injuries. Any movement or physical activity that causes you to twist or rotate your knee with the pressure of your entire body weight can lead to a torn meniscus.

     

    Symptoms Of A Meniscus Tear

    • Popping sensation
    • Swelling of the knee
    • Stiffness 
    • Pain when twisting or rotating
    • Trouble straightening your knee 
    • Locking of the knee
    • Buckling of the knee

    What is a Torn ACL?

    The anterior cruciate ligament is essential to your proper functioning, as it helps keep your tibia from moving in front of your femur and is key to the rotational stability of the knee. When the ACL tears, it is very likely that parts of the knee, such as other ligaments or cartilage, will also be damaged.     A torn ACL is most common in athletes, as pivoting or landing poorly can cause the injury. While such a step cannot be predicted, building muscle strength is important.

    Nonsurgical Treatment

    This includes treating the knee only through physical therapy, rehabilitation, and possibly a knee brace. It may be suitable for children and those with partial tears or maintained instability, but it is generally not advised. Not having surgery may lead to further injury due to instability.

     

    Surgical Treatment

    The most success in surgical procedures has been found through replacing the ACL with a tendon graft. These tendons may be from the patella, quadriceps, or hamstring. This surgery is often recommended for adult patients who are engaged in work or sports that require cutting or pivoting motions, as secondary knee injury is more likely in these individuals.

     

    Physical Therapy

    This may be used as a nonsurgical recovery technique or be done after surgery. It will help reduce swelling and increase strength, mobility, and range of motion.
